ISPE Releases Good Practice Guide: Single-Use Technology

Nov. 12, 2018
The guide from the International Society for Pharmaceutical Engineering provides a roadmap for efficient implementation of single-use technology with minimum disruptions to existing operations.

The International Society for Pharmaceutical Engineering (ISPE) releases its latest guide, ISPE Good Practice Guide: Single-Use Technology. The guide provides a roadmap for efficient implementation of single-use technology (SUT) with minimum disruptions to existing operations.

"Single-use technology addresses the need for equipment that is faster and more flexible to implement while retaining a controlled or closed product flow path,” says John Bournas, ISPE CEO and president. "This Guide is a valuable resource centered around getting single-use technology implementation done right the first time, on schedule and with minimal costs and few surprises.”

From the guide, users will learn: 

  • How to select single-use components and design functional systems
  • When and how to perform effective extractables and leachables studies
  • How to evaluate suppliers of SUT
